Other Electromechanical & Instrumentation & Maintenance Technologies/Technicians is the 375th most popular major in the country with 2,032 degrees awarded in 2019-2020.
Across the Southeast region, there were 1,534 other electromechanical and instrumentation and maintenance technologies/technicians gra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the associate degree level specifically, there were 497 other electromechanical and instrumentation and maintenance technologies/technicians graduates with average earnings and debt of $31,631 and $18,547 respectively.
